Sorry to reply to my own thread, but I'd really like to have all of our
clients' Bacula servers send only one "intervention needed" email per Job if
possible and am not sure if this would need to become a feature request or if
it is something that I just plain missed - even though I have scoured the docs

Below is my original message with Dan's cut-n-paste of my comments in #bacula
on freenode the other day.

>> Does anyone know where I can find the schedule that Bacula follows when
>> sending operator notifications (eg: Intervention needed... for mounting a
>> volume etc)?
>>
>> Thought I saw it somewhere once, possibly on this list but can not find it 
>> now.
>>
>> I would like to set it to "never resend" if possible, but I think it is
>> hard-coded.
> 
> Bill told me this on IRC:
> 
> All of our clients' bacula servers (including ours) send email to our help 
> desk software
> which creates a new ticket and notifies workers for EACH "intervention 
> needed" email. 
> We only need to get one since the ticket system will not let us forget about 
> it, and having
> 20 tickets with the same subject, for the same problem just causes us more 
> work (e.g.: 
> we need to close all 220 or merge them all into one and then and close that 
> one)
